Background
Lynette Posorske, M.D., is an infectious disease physician with Johns Hopkins Community Physicians. She helps patients and their family members navigate through vulnerable and stressful conditions. Dr. Posorske has expertise in various infectious diseases, including HIV and sexually transmitted diseases (STDs).
Dr. Posorske enjoys being able to combine her science background with the close patient interactions clinical medicine provides. She is honored to be part of her patients’ lives.
She grew up in Sacramento, California, and after completing her undergraduate degree she moved to the East Coast where she settled down. Dr. Posorske met her husband while studying at Cornell University, and together they have two children and a granddaughter.
In her limited free time, she enjoys singing and playing classical piano. Dr. Posorske is a member of her church and community choirs. She also loves cooking (and eating!).
